Social Media Officer

Job description

A national children's charity in London, seek two Social Media Officers ASAP until end March 2020.

The roles will support the Digital Manager and will emphasis of Community Management, Supporter Care and Safeguarding.

Duties:
Act on the frontline of our main social media accounts
by interacting with supporters and the public in real
time on various web and social platforms
Monitor, track and report on feedback and online
reviews
Respond to supporters in a timely manner
Flag any negative comments/inappropriate content to
the Digital Marketing Manager, and formulate strategy
to best resolve the issue
Originate and produce creative content (ie. copy,
images, graphics, video, etc) related to topical news
stories and our appeals and campaigns to spark
conversation and engagement
Working across fundraising, strategic-communications
and campaigns teams, plan, develop, implement and
analyse campaigns of all sizes
Coordinate, build and monitor social media advertising
campaigns
Continuously monitor relevant online conversations
across all the brand's active social media platforms
Coordinate and implement the social media schedule
Ensure consistency of messages across multiple
networks
Track social media influence using reporting tools
Prepare reports for the team / internal stakeholders on
usage and reach statistics on a weekly and monthly
basis, and recommend optimisation or action based
on the results
